摘要
We study the strong convergence of a hybrid steepest descent method with variable parameters for the general variational inequality (GVI)[inline-graphic not available: see fulltext]. Consequently, as an application, we obtain some results concerning the constrained generalized pseudoinverse. Our results extend and improve the result of Yao and Noor (2007) and many others.
